The Minor Three Boston, Massachusetts
The Minor Three are a classic power trio...sort of. There is dynamic energy like the Jimi Hendrix Experience, and heavy blues-tinged riffs like The Black Keys. The writing is personal and intelligent and the sound is fresh and modern with references to a myriad of influences, old and new. ... more
